1. No Verifiable Regulation
The most critical factor when evaluating any trading platform is regulation.
Regulated brokers must:
-
Hold client funds in segregated accounts
-
Undergo audits
-
Maintain capital requirements
-
Follow strict advertising and transparency rules
-
Offer legal protections to traders
MRXCapitalTrading.com does not clearly display verifiable licensing information from recognized regulatory authorities. When licensing cannot be verified independently, traders cannot know whether any protection exists if something goes wrong.
Unregulated platforms can:
-
Change terms without notice
-
Restrict withdrawals
-
Disappear or shut down
-
Avoid legal accountability
Because trading inherently involves financial risk, working with a regulated entity is one of the strongest safety measures available.

How to Protect Yourself When Evaluating Trading Platforms
Before opening or funding an account with any broker, take these steps:
1. Verify Regulation
Always independently confirm licensing on official regulator websites.
2. Check for Transparency
Look for:
-
Company registration details
-
Physical address
-
Legal terms
-
Full fee breakdown
3. Avoid Guaranteed Profit Claims
No genuine broker can eliminate risk.
4. Test Support Early
Contact support before depositing funds.
5. Start With a Small Deposit
Evaluate performance and withdrawal behavior.
6. Research User Feedback
Look for patterns, not isolated complaints.
7. Never Allow Remote Access
No broker needs access to your device.
